Define sequence S(a_0,a_1) by a_{n+2} is least integer such that a_{n+2}/a_{n+1}>a_{n+1}/a_n for n >= 0. This is S(3,4). |

| 3, 4, 6, 10, 17, 29, 50, 87, 152, 266, 466, 817, 1433, 2514, 4411, 7740, 13582, 23834, 41825, 73397, 128802, 226031, 396656, 696082, 1221538, 2143649, 3761841, 6601570, 11584947, 20330164, 35676950
